About

Sun Kun Oh is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, General Health Professions and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Sun Kun Oh has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 40 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 1 paper in General Health Professions and 1 paper in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Sun Kun Oh's work include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(4 papers),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(3 papers) and Black Holes and Theoretical Physics (2 papers). Sun Kun Oh is often cited by papers focused on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(4 papers),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(3 papers) and Black Holes and Theoretical Physics (2 papers). Sun Kun Oh collaborates with scholars based in South Korea and Germany. Sun Kun Oh's co-authors include Hyun Kyu Lee, Jong Sung Kim, Sung Soo Kim and Hyun Soo Kim and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Physics G Nuclear and Particle Physics, Journal of Physics G Nuclear Physics and Gajeong yihag hoeji.
